What Are the Key Airbnb Metrics in Batu Kawan?
In Batu Kawan, the headline Airbnb metrics are $2,978 in average annual revenue,23.4% occupancy, $53 ADR, and $13 in RevPAR, and guests book about 48 days in advance.
How Much Do Airbnb Hosts Earn Monthly in Batu Kawan?
Understanding the monthly revenue variations for Airbnb listings in Batu Kawan is key to maximizing your short term rental income potential. Seasonality significantly impacts earnings. Our analysis, based on data from the past 12 months, shows that the peak revenue month for STRs in Batu Kawan is typically October, while December often presents the lowest earnings, highlighting opportunities for strategic pricing adjustments during shoulder and low seasons. Explore the typical Airbnb income in Batu Kawan across different performance tiers: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ve $894+ monthly, often utilizing dynamic pricing and superior guest experiences.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) earn $622 or more, indicating effective management and desirable locations/amenities.
- Typical properties (Median) generate around $312 per month, representing the average market performance.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) see earnings around $129, often with potential for optimization.

What Is the Monthly Airbnb Occupancy Rate in Batu Kawan?
Maximize your bookings by understanding the Batu Kawan STR occupancy trends. Seasonal demand shifts significantly influence how often properties are booked. Typically, Junesees the highest demand (peak season occupancy), while December experiences the lowest (low season). Effective strategies, like adjusting minimum stays or offering promotions, can boost occupancy during slower periods. Here's how different property tiers perform in Batu Kawan: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ve 55%+ occupancy, indicating high desirability and potentially optimized availability.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) maintain 39% or higher occupancy, suggesting good market fit and guest satisfaction.
- Typical properties (Median) have an occupancy rate around 21%.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) average 10% occupancy, potentially facing higher vacancy.

What Is the Average Airbnb Nightly Rate in Batu Kawan?
Effective short term rental pricing strategy in Batu Kawan involves understanding monthly ADR fluctuations. The Average Daily Rate (ADR) for Airbnb in Batu Kawan typically peaks in October and dips lowest during April. Leveraging Airbnb dynamic pricing tools or strategies based on this seasonality can significantly boost revenue. Here's a look at the typical nightly rates achieved: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) command rates of $89+ per night, often due to premium features or locations.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) achieve nightly rates of $68 or more.
- Typical properties (Median) charge around $44 per night.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) earn around $34 per night.

When Is the Peak Season for Airbnb in Batu Kawan?
Batu Kawan's peak Airbnb season falls in October, September, April, while the softest stretch is January, May, December. Overall, the market shows highly seasonal trends requiring careful strategy, which should guide pricing, minimum stays, and cash-flow planning.
Peak Season (October, September, April)
- Revenue averages $581 per month
- Occupancy rates average 32.3%
- Daily rates average $54
Shoulder Season
- Revenue averages $445 per month
- Occupancy maintains around 28.6%
- Daily rates hold near $54
Low Season (January, May, December)
- Revenue drops to average $285 per month
- Occupancy decreases to average 17.9%
- Daily rates adjust to average $52

Which Airbnb Amenities Boost Revenue in Batu Kawan?
Not every amenity matters equally. This table focuses on the amenities most associated with higher revenue in Batu Kawan, which makes it more useful for prioritizing upgrades than a simple popularity list alone.
| Amenity | Prevalence | Revenue With | Revenue Without | Revenue Uplift |
|---|---|---|---|---|
Free parking on premises | 76.2% | $3,666 | $773 | 374.1% |
Backyard | 23.8% | $5,315 | $2,247 | 136.5% |
Refrigerator | 47.6% | $4,247 | $1,824 | 132.9% |
Hot water | 66.7% | $3,671 | $1,591 | 130.7% |
Dedicated workspace | 42.9% | $4,393 | $1,916 | 129.3% |
Cooking basics | 42.9% | $4,233 | $2,036 | 107.9% |
Bidet | 33.3% | $4,505 | $2,214 | 103.5% |
Iron | 61.9% | $3,675 | $1,844 | 99.3% |
Smoke alarm | 38.1% | $3,901 | $2,409 | 61.9% |
Hot water kettle | 38.1% | $3,795 | $2,475 | 53.3% |
Revenue Impact Insights for Batu Kawan
- Free parking on premises tops the revenue impact list with a 374.1% uplift — listings with this amenity earn $3,666 vs. $773 without it.

How Much Are Airbnb Cleaning Fees in Batu Kawan?
Cleaning fees in Batu Kawan are meaningful operating levers, not just pass-through charges. What matters most is how often hosts charge them, how high they run relative to market norms, and how large a share of gross revenue they consume.
Cleaning Fee Insights for Batu Kawan
- About 66.7% of Batu Kawan listings charge a cleaning fee — a mixed market where some hosts absorb the cost into nightly rates while others break it out.
- The gap between the average ($40) and median ($18) cleaning fee indicates some high-end properties are pulling the average up considerably.
- Cleaning fees represent 6.4% of gross revenue on average — a modest component of the overall booking price.
